AngelQ was created by Josh Thurman and Tim Estes in May 2025 as a safe alternative for families to give their children internet access without as much risk of finding age-inappropriate content. Generative AI is a type of artificial intelligence that creates new content–such as text, images, code, music, and videos–based on patterns it has learned from existing data. One of the most common generative AI tools is ChatGPT. To use ChatGPT, simply ask a question or type a prompt, and it will produce a response. If the response is not satisfactory, you can continue prompting it until it meets your needs. Some people have even replaced their traditional search engines with generative AI.  Perhaps you are wondering what the usefulness of generative AI is. Book Review: “The Anxious Generation” by Jonathan Haidt Jonathan Haidt, social psychologist and author of acclaimed works like “The Coddling of the American Mind”, returns with “The Anxious Generation: How the Great Rewiring of Childhood is Causing an Epidemic of Mental Illness”. In this book, Haidt tackles one of the most urgent questions of our time: Why are rates of anxiety, depression, and other mental health challenges skyrocketing among young people? Haidt’s analysis is both sharply secular in its methodology and, quite surprisingly, convergent with the views of some of today’s most vocal conservative Christian commentators—particularly when it comes to recommendations. A Rigorous, Secular Analysis Haidt takes care to ground his arguments in comprehensive psychological research, demographic analysis, and a synthesis of national data. Discord is a popular platform for voice, video, and text communication. Originally used by gamers as a way to communicate between different gaming platforms, the app is increasingly being used by people from various communities, including for educational purposes, hobbies, and professional groups - some companies are using it to replace Zoom. On Discord, users can create or join servers, communicate in real-time, and share content with other users of common interests. Besides posting to certain servers where everybody can see, users can privately message each other. Math-focused artificial intelligence (AI) tools offer a new way to support students in learning and practicing math at home. From tools that provide interactive explanations to apps that help solve and visualize problems, there are many resources available that can enhance understanding and make math more approachable. Here’s what parents should consider: 1. Benefits of Math AI Tools Step-by-Step Explanations: Tools like Photomath, Microsoft Math Solver, and Khan Academy’s AI-driven practice provide guided steps, helping students understand each stage of problem-solving. Personalized Practice: Many apps, like Prodigy or DreamBox, adjust difficulty based on the student’s skill level, ensuring challenges are appropriate and minimizing frustration. About a year ago, ‘My AI’ made its debut on top of the conversation list inside the Snapchat app - with no way to remove it*. AI has popped up in many places since then, and we may continually be wondering, “what does this mean?” or “how much data is being collected?” or “can I turn this off?”  As with most AI uses, Snapchat is using this feature to tailor content to its users in order to make their platform more appealing to the user. The app admits that “My AI’s responses may include biased, incorrect, harmful, or misleading content” and that “you should not share confidential or sensitive information”; but it also allows the conversations that have been stored to be deleted.
